This is a vintage, working, 1960s English Clock Systems Smiths Clockwork Darkroom Clock / Timer. A mechanical timer made by English Clock Systems (ECS), which was part of Smiths Industries.
In fair cosmetic condition with the cream-beige coating missing in a few areas. The glass face is also scuffed making it slightly cloudy but still readable. The chrome parts of the clock are slightly rusty.
You wind the clock using the key on the rear and then start/stop the timer by lifting/depressing the lever on the left. The right side lever resets the hand to zero. The black hand counts elapsed time up to 60 minutes and the red hand counts seconds. Unlike most kitchen count down timers, you can't set a specific time, e.g. 30 minutes, and there is no alarm. It literally is a time counter like a large stopwatch.
Useful in Photographic darkrooms as the levers are easy to find when you're working in safelight!
